Assume Form
The ugothol spends 10 minutes reshaping its appearance to take on the shape of any Small or Medium humanoid. It gains a +4 circumstance bonus to Deception checks to pass as that creature.
Blood Nourishment
The ugothol uses its three-pronged tongue to drink the blood of an adjacent or creature. The creature gains Drained 1
Compression
When the ugothol successfully Squeezes, it moves through the tight space at full speed. Narrow confines are not difficult terrain for an ugothol.
Revert Form
Requirements The ugothol is in an assumed form
Effect The ugothol resumes its true form. Until the start of its next turn, it gains a +2 status bonus to attack rolls, damage rolls, saving throws, and skill checks.
Sneak Attack
The ugothol deals 1d6 extra precision damage to creatures.
